Interface Cult // Interface Cultures at Ars Electronica Festival 2021

Interface Cult is part of Loops of Wisdom, Kunstuniversität Linz Campus at Ars Electronica 2021. 8th-12th of September 2021, at Kunstuniversität Linz, Hauptplatz 8, Linz

Contemporary artists, designers and inventors are creating new connections and systems, exploring how Silicon, Organic and even speculatively Alien forms of life are entangling, mutating, evolving. What can these new entities and relationships look like? Are they friendships and collaboration or competitions and conflict? For these new exchanges we need new languages: programmable, aesthetic, interspecies, non-human and post-scientific.

Students of Interface Cultures, University of Art and Design Linz, have developed works which combine current technologies with ancient, humanistic and esoteric practices, delving into topics such as, divination, twirlings, the subconscious/unconscious, secrets, rituals, leisures, energies, contemplation, along with cults, both old and new.
